Understanding Government Incentives
Government incentives encompass a range of grants, tax credits, and rebates aimed at promoting sustainable practices among homeowners. Whether you’re an experienced gardener or just beginning your green journey, these programs can significantly support the installation and enhancement of greenhouses. The key is knowing where to look!
Beyond the financial aspect, local governments often provide workshops and educational resources focused on best practices for greenhouse gardening. Engaging in these opportunities not only enhances your skills and knowledge but also helps you connect with fellow gardening enthusiasts who share your passion.
Environmental Impact and Sustainability
Greenhouse gardening marries personal joy with a commitment to environmental responsibility. Given the growing discourse around climate change and sustainability, there’s no better time to make a positive impact through your gardening practices. Homeowners can embrace eco-friendly methods, such as utilizing renewable energy sources, collecting rainwater, and implementing organic gardening techniques.
Furthermore, government incentives champion practices that help reduce our carbon footprints. By growing your own food, you diminish the need for long-distance transportation of produce, significantly lowering emissions. Additionally, fostering local biodiversity in your greenhouse can attract beneficial insects and pollinators, creating a more vibrant garden ecosystem.
